**Management Meeting Minutes — Westbrook Expansion**

Attendees: regional leads plus ops. Quick recap for sales leads: we agreed to open the Tarnholm region in Q2, starting with two reps and a shared support pod. Velora product line goes first; pricing stays standard for launch. Marn will circulate territory splits by Friday. Keep this quiet until the announcement. The strategic rationale is noted below.

board note of kageg-bahof: The renewal with Holwynax Holdings closes at $2 million a year, 5 percent below the last contract. Project Ulaath slips by two quarters because of the supplier delay.

14:07 — On-call confirmed the bounce processor had stopped consuming from the intake queue roughly forty minutes earlier. Queue depth had grown to 180k messages, and suppression-list updates were stale, meaning the Copperfield campaign continued sending to hard-bounced addresses. The proximate trigger was a malformed bounce payload from an upstream relay, which crashed the parser loop on every restart. For the release manager's records, the deploy in question carries the build token below.

build token for fajof-yahof: htk4_869f

Handover Note — Divestiture of the Lanterwick Unit

From: D. Okonu, outgoing. To: S. Breville, incoming. The sale of the Lanterwick packaging unit is in late-stage diligence. Key contacts, data-room access, and the separation workplan are in the shared tracker. Staff communications are on hold until signing. The strategic rationale is summarised in the note below.

confidential, kagup-bafog: Fraaxax Group is in early talks to buy Soroxox Group for about $343.8 million. The Olidor launch date is June 14, and nothing goes to the press before then. Legal wants the Aldmirek Logistics term sheet signed before July 23.

Leadership Briefing — Brennick Licensing Dispute

Quick summary: Brennick Systems claims our Ardel module exceeds the seat count in our licence. Their number looks inflated, but we're exposed on roughly 200 seats. Legal suggests settling quietly; estimated cost is manageable and cheaper than arbitration. We'll need a provision booked this quarter. How this ties into our wider plans is outlined below.

board note of baweg-bawig: Project Tamath slips by six weeks because of the audit delay.